Understanding API Security: The Power of Attribute-Based Access Control (ABAC)

Securing our digital world, especially when it comes to APIs, is crucial for tech-savvy managers overseeing technology operations. One of the best ways to ensure API security is through Attribute-Based Access Control (ABAC). Today, we'll explore what ABAC is, why it matters, and how it can be quickly implemented using tools like hoop.dev.

What is Attribute-Based Access Control (ABAC)?

ABAC is a method of controlling access based on a variety of attributes or characteristics. These attributes can relate to the user, such as their role or location, the resource being accessed, and the actions they are trying to perform. Instead of using a simple "yes"or "no"system, ABAC considers multiple factors before granting access.

Why API Security Needs ABAC

API Security is a crucial topic for companies dealing with sensitive data. Here’s what makes ABAC vital:

  • Flexibility: ABAC allows customized access rules meaning it adapts to different situations, providing more tailored security.
  • Scalability: As your company grows, so do your APIs. ABAC can handle increasing complexity without sacrificing security.
  • Contextual Awareness: ABAC takes into account context, such as the time of day or the user's past behavior, to make smarter access decisions.

How to Implement ABAC for API Security

Implementing ABAC might seem daunting, but with the right tools, like hoop.dev, it becomes manageable. Tech managers can follow these simple steps:

  1. Identify Key Attributes: Start by figuring out what attributes are most important for your API security. This could include user roles, locations, or specific user actions.
  2. Define Policies: Create rules that correspond to these attributes. For example, a healthcare app might allow doctors access to patient data only from certain devices or locations.
  3. Use Tools: Platforms like hoop.dev streamline the process of applying ABAC by offering easy-to-use interfaces and pre-built templates.
  4. Test and Monitor: Regularly check the effectiveness of your ABAC rules and make adjustments as necessary.

Benefits of Using hoop.dev for ABAC

Hoop.dev offers remarkable simplicity in setting up ABAC for technology managers. Here’s why hoop.dev stands out:

  • Quick Setup: Hoop.dev allows for a swift setup, letting you see ABAC in action in just minutes.
  • User-Friendly Interface: Technical managers will appreciate the intuitive design, making it easy to navigate and configure access policies.
  • Robust Support: With plenty of resources and customer support, hoop.dev helps you address API security challenges effectively.

Secure your company's APIs effectively with ABAC, and consider trying out hoop.dev to experience these benefits firsthand. Discover how quickly you can enhance your security posture by seeing ABAC solutions live in minutes. Head over to hoop.dev and start securing your system today.